Output 21573b627f4fa9c97b132952471b78176c0b09218a09d95b058ea6530dd130a5:0

value
43361040
script pubkey
OP_HASH160 OP_PUSHBYTES_20 33f82525a66f6785f62e5dbb59ebbc4147b993ec OP_EQUAL
address
36RoekXgCv8i86tBQfr3JiEfXiRDMZ7pHw
transaction
21573b627f4fa9c97b132952471b78176c0b09218a09d95b058ea6530dd130a5
confirmations
410932
spent
true